Diphenyl-1-pyrenylphosphine (DPPP) serves as a fluoregenic peroxide-reactive probe, facilitating the detection of reactive oxygen species. This compound exhibits a distinctive phototriggered aggregation-induced emission (AIE) and aggregation-induced quenching (ACQ) transition, showcasing significant alterations in its third-order nonlinear optical signals. DPPP is ideal for research applications involving oxidative stress and the study of ROS-related biological processes.
